  Unicode is a fascinating mess. Most known and often used coding is UTF-8. Furthermore, since UTF-8 cannot be set as the encoding for narrow string WinAPI, one must compile his code with UNICODE define. Basically, they are standards on how to represent difference characters in binary so that they can be written, stored, transmitted, and read in digital media. It's fascinating in many ways, but one of the most interesting one is how well it works given the complexity. August 8, Unicode support in Enterprise COBOL for z/OS and OS/390! Enable basic Unicode processing for COBOL applications ! !UTF-8 & UTF-16 for Unicode In simple terms, what are character encodings? What is Unicode, UTF-8, and others? What is a 16-bit Unicode character? What is the difference between ASCII and Unicode? Looking for a see-and-click solution. For those of you programming in Java using the Eclipse IDE, this article will explain all the steps you should take to make sure your project is using Unicode and it's preferred encoding UTF-8 everywhere, to ensure your applications work well with all characters from all languages used around the world. For example, right arrow is: 0xE2 0x86 0x92 in UTF-8 but it is 0x2192 in Unicode. Character encodings for beginners. To use UTF-8 with Mutt, nothing needs to be put in the configuration files. Configuring web browsers to display Unicode in OS X (Macintosh) Under General > Languages, chose Unicode (UTF-8). This article covers what the lack of Unicode support in PHP means, and demonstrates the use of the Portable UTF-8 library. UTF-8 là một cách mã hóa để có tác This page contains tools to convert/escape unicode text to entities Decode/Encode Unicode text Encode/Escape The most commonly used encodings are UTF-8 UTF-8 Conversion Notes. UTF-8 encodes each Unicode character as a variable number of 1 to 4 octets, where the number of octets depends on the integer value assigned to the Unicode character. For example, the English alphabet "A" to "Z" and "a" to "z" can be a character set, with a total of 52 symbols. Unicode, UTF8 & Character Sets: It is at position 128 in ISO-8859-1 and has the Unicode value 8364. UTF-8 encoding table and Unicode characters page with code points U+0000 to U+00FF For email transmission of Unicode, the UTF-8 character set and the Base64 or the Quoted-printable transfer encoding are recommended. The Unicode Consortium develops the Unicode Standard. UTF-8 is a mapping method to represent all Unicode characters as a sequence of bytes. A Unicode database is a database with a UTF-8 character set as the database character set. Encoding your Excel files into a UTF format (UTF-8 or UTF-16) can help to ensure anything you upload into SurveyGizmo can be read and displayed properly. Resources to help you learn how to handle Unicode in your Python programs: Contents. Creating the database¶. UTF-8 was not really designed to preferentially encode English text. Text in 8th is stored in the UTF-8 encoding, which says "Native support for Unicode via UTF-8 throughout the library" was added as of S-Lang 2. After migrating a complete Tom perlunicode - Unicode support in Perl. Unicode fonts for the text console are usually shipped with major Linux distributions. How to display Unicode languages in To get Unicode to display in Windows and your browser only takes Internet Explorer 11 has selected Unicode (UTF-8) Even though the code points of UTF-8 and ANSI are pretty much identical, "Difference Between ANSI and Unicode. From it was determined that only UTF-8 can be safely used as a UNICODE encoding in HL7 messages and as of HL7 version 2. While Unicode standard allows BOM in UTF-8, it does not require or recommend it. The Absolute Minimum Every Software Developer Unicode was a brave This has the neat side effect that English text looks exactly the same in UTF-8 as it Helps you convert between Unicode character numbers, characters, UTF-8 and UTF-16 code units in hex, percent escapes,and Numeric Character References (hex and decimal). While virtually all database engines can handle either (and also support UTF-32 in most cases), some methods of manipulating data will work better with UTF-8. This page is encoded in UTF-8. The screen shot shows Japanese, English and Thai text encoded as UTF-8 Unicode. Starting with CLDR v22. Conversion to the legacy Thai code page would lose the Japanese characters. The Unicode application sends UTF-8 function calls to the Driver Manager. Table used for debugging common UTF-8 character encoding problems List of keyboard shortcuts (key combinations, access keys) for Windows and MAC OSX as well as list of all relevant character tables (Unicode / UTF-8) Unicode or UTF-8 - posted in Ask for Help: Hi, Could you please help me to use Unicode (special characters) in Autohotkey. It was accepted by ISO at UTF-8. UTF-8 is becoming the most popular For email transmission of Unicode, the UTF-8 character set and the Base64 or the Quoted-printable transfer encoding are recommended, Unicode is a superset of every other significant computerized character set on earth today. Setting Your Locale to UTF-8 In order to take full advantage of Unicode on your Linux or other UNIX system, you will need to set your locale to a UTF-8 locale. Unicode Drivers. 1, versioned charts are available: Character Encoding Starting with version 0. Is Unicode a 16-bit encoding? Can Unicode text be represented in more than one way? What is a UTF? For compatibility with 8-bit and 7-bit environments, Unicode can also be encoded as UTF-8 and UTF-7, respectively. WHAT IS UNICODE? For example, the following meta element identifies Unicode UTF-8 as the character set for the document. UTF-8 is the more commonly-used standard for now. "あ" is not a Unicode character, A "UTF-8 character" is an oxymoron, Unicode character properties. UTF-8 encodes each Unicode character as a variable number of 1 to 4 octets, where the number of octets depends on the integer value assigned to the Unicode character. This document lists the various space characters in Unicode. The Unicode Consortium has approved the following 41 emoji characters as part of Unicode 8. How to encode and decode strings in Python between Unicode, UTF-8 and other formats. For all other encodings, you have to trust heuristics based on statistics. However, you must configure Outlook 2010 to use Unicode UTF-8 text encoding to combine non-Latin characters with English characters in email messages. Files containing only 7-bit ASCII characters are unchanged when viewed in the Unicode UTF-8 encoding, so plain ASCII files are already valid Unicode files. This encoding supports all Unicode character values. The font designated by the long "-fn" option is Markus Kuhn's Unicode font. If p does not point to a valid UTF-8 encoded character, results are undefined. Microsoft has often mistakenly used 'Unicode' and 'widechar' as synonyms for both 'UCS-2' and 'UTF-16'. The Unicode standard UTF-8 encoding table and Unicode characters page with code points U+0000 to U+00FF Unicode Transformation Formats: UTF-8 & Co. Convert between Unicode and other code pages and character sets with TextPipe Charset. UTF-8 is a multibyte encoding able to encode the whole Unicode charset. Text Encoding Converter is an easy-to-use application for Windows that can help you convert Encoding of multiple ansi/ utf-8/ unicode/HTML Entity Encoding plain UTF-8 example. In the context of application development, Unicode with UTF-8 encoding is the best way to support multiple languages in your application. CSV, comma separated values, is a common format when saving information in a tabular form. This tutorial explains the utf-8 way of representing characters in a computer; later generalizing (high level) how any kind of data can be represented in a c IDM PowerTips Unicode text and Unicode files in UltraEdit/UEStudio. Unlike native Excel format, it is cross-platform and requires no How do I change the encoding of my HTML pages to Unicode/UTF-8? An encoded character takes between 1 and 4 bytes. Unicode UTF-16 and UTF-8 are now fully supported by Windows 2000 and XP. Unicode support for supplementary characters requires character sets that have a range A UTF-8 encoding of the Unicode character set using one to three bytes Up-to-date documentation for the latest stable version of Moodle may be available here: Converting files to UTF-8. Tips for using this tool: If your conversion The Windows SDK provides the WideCharToMultiByte function to convert a Unicode, or UTF-16, string (WCHAR*) to a character string (CHAR*) using a particular code page. UTF-8 is the 8-bit encoding form of Unicode. Function URLEncode in the WebHelpers module do not convert correctly Unicode characters! When sending json with non-Unicode characters it will broken. Unicode Security Software Vulnerability Testing Guide UTF-8 Each Unicode code point is assigned to an unsigned byte sequence of one to four bytes in FYI, the usage of the BOM with UTF-8 is strongly discouraged and really only a Microsoft-ism. To avoid Java/Tomcat unicode issues after moving to a new environment you need to verify locale settings, especially LC ALL. x vs Python 2. A simple, portable and lightweigt C++ library for easy handling of UTF-8 encoded strings Character encoding is a name ("utf-8", "iso-8859-1", etc. For a description, consult chapter 6 Writing Systems and Punctuation and block description General Punctuation in the Unicode standard. A look at string encoding in Python 3. Convert plain text (letters, sometimes numbers, sometimes punctuation) to obscure characters from Unicode. Unicode is a character set that aims to define all characters and glyphs from all human languages, living and dead. How to use Unicode and the multilingual features of HTML 4 to produce Web pages UTF-8 is the normal character encoding for any HTML file that contains UTF-8은 유니코드를 사용하기 힘들고 크기가 중요할 경우 유니코드 표준 압축 방식(Standard Compression Scheme for Unicode) Convert Unicode characters in UTF-16, UTF-8, and UTF-32 formats to their Unicode and decimal representations and vice versa. It is expected that this cardinality will grow to more than 100'000 soon, through additional definitions for characters that do not yet have a coding, so that all the world's characters Ken Thompson and Rob Pike proposed a trick to make ASCII a proper subset of Unicode. Unicode Manipulation. Unicode Table (in UTF-8) Unicode samplers and resources offsite: UTF-8 Sampler / The Kermit Project / Columbia University How to guess the encoding of a document?¶ Only ASCII, UTF-8 and encodings using a BOM (UTF-7 with BOM, UTF-8 with BOM, UTF-16, and UTF-32) have reliable algorithms to get the encoding of a document. Output vector bytes has the same general array shape as the unicodestr input. The encoding is defined by the Unicode standard, and was originally designed by Ken Thompson and Rob Pike. Python Forums on Bytes. bytes = unicode2native(unicodestr) converts the input Unicode ® character representation, unicodestr, to the user default encoding, and returns the bytes as a uint8 vector, bytes. Unicode emoji is gaining popularity again. UTF-8 encoding supports longer byte sequences, up to 6 bytes, but the biggest code point of Unicode 6. A general principle of UTF-8 is that the first byte either is a single-byte character (if below 0x80), or indicates length of multi-byte code by the number of 1's before the first 0 and is then filled up with data bits. For instance, under Internet Explorer, you can select 'View | Encoding' The Unicode CLDR Charts provide different ways to view the Common Locale Data Repository data. Range Decimal Name; 0x0000-0x007F: 0-127: Basic Latin 0x0080-0x00FF: 128-255: Latin-1 Supplement 0x0100-0x017F: 256-383: Latin Extended-A 0x0180-0x024F 6 Supporting Multilingual Databases with Unicode. Programming: Converting Latin to Unicode (UTF-8) Converting from Latin to UTF-8 (and back) in your code. Unicode is the standard for encoding text in almost all languages with support for migrating from C strings including fast translation to and from UTF-8, Unicode Supplementary Characters that are useful for testing 4-byte UTF-8 and 2-word UTF-16 UTF-8 (8-bit Unicode Transformation Format- informática avançada) é um tipo de codificação binária (Unicode) de comprimento variável criado por Ken Thompson e Rob Pike. The ISO 10646 Universal Character Set (UCS, Unicode) is a coded character set with more than 40'000 defined elements. UTF8Encoding encodes Unicode characters using the UTF-8 encoding. It's the official IANA code for the UTF-8 character encoding. and therefore can only be viewed properly with a Unicode-compliant browser, and the UTF-8 links denote UCS Transformation Format 8. Moodle uses UTF-8 encoding to be able to support different languages. UTF-8に対するUTF-16のようなものだが、RFC公開時点のUnicodeで文字が定義されていた4 Varamozhi Project. UTF-7 and UTF-8 are both types of Unicode Transformation Format, the standard used to encode 16-bit Unicode characters such as international letters and special symbols in a Useful, free online tool for that converts UTF8-encoded data to text. UTF-8 is the proper binary encoding of the Unicode character set. We assume you have The option "-u8" turns on Unicode and UTF-8 handling. No ads, nonsense or garbage, just a UTF8 decoder. 广义的 Unicode 是一个标准,定义了一个字符集以及一系列的编码规则,即 Unicode 字符集和 UTF-8、UTF-16、UTF-32 This HOWTO discusses Python support for Unicode, The default encoding for Python source code is UTF-8, so you can simply include a Unicode character in a string UTF-8 is a variable width character encoding capable of encoding all 1,112,064 valid code points in Unicode using one to four 8-bit bytes. Code page is the name that SAP uses instead of character encoding. To enable UTF-8 on the console, run unicode_start UTF-8( 8-bit Unicode Transformation Format )是一種針對Unicode的可變長度字元編碼,也是一种前缀码。 它可以用來表示Unicode標準中的任何字元,且其編碼中的第一個位元組仍與ASCII相容,這使得原來處理ASCII字元的軟體無須或只須做少部份修改,即可繼續使用。 Unicode Transformations: Finding Elusive Vulnerabilities. Unicode spaces. UTF-8 is a specific encoding of Unicode used by many applications. Sample Unicode Documents. In Internet Explorer, it can be done by either Right mouse click->Encoding->Unicode(UTF-8) UnicodeとUTF-8の違いは? - Humanityはあんなに反響があるとは思わなかった。 ブコメにコピペじゃなくてまとめを書いてくれれば良い資料になるのにと書いてあったので今度は自分の知識をまとめてみる。 Unicode is a character encoding standard, developed by the Unicode Consortium, which defines a set of letters, numbers, and symbols that represent almost all of the A character encoding tells the computer how to interpret raw zeroes and ones into real characters. Unicode is a standard for writing in different languages on a computer. UTF-8 is backwards For any character equal to or below 127 (hex 0x7F), the UTF-8 representation is one byte. Since 5. The files are stored on the application server. Miscellaneous Symbols ☀ 2600 2600 ☁ 2601 2601 ☂ 2602 Unicode Transformation Format: UTF-8. Its goal is to encode Unicode characters in single byte where possible The first and last byte are valid UTF-8 encodings of ASCII, but the middle byte (0xFC) is not a valid byte in UTF-8. Although the future is Unicode, Windows will continue to support ANSI and Code Pages for Overcoming frustration: Correctly using unicode in python2 Each unicode encoding (UTF-8, UTF-7, UTF-16, UTF-32, etc) maps different sequences of bytes to the UCS vs UTF-8 as Internal String Encoding. The aim of this project is to develop a set of free collection of UTF-8 is a variable width character encoding capable of encoding all 1,112,064 valid code points in Unicode using one to four 8-bit bytes. Overview Package utf8 implements functions and constants to support text encoded in UTF-8. It’s not used on Linux or Macs and just tends to get in the way of things. Configuring Browsers for Unicode. The output is fully cut-n-pastable text. After Outlook Express has a Unicode encoding and a compatible font, Arabic, English, Greek, and Hebrew This chapter explains how FLTK handles international text via Unicode and UTF-8. But we can't write How do I get perl to properly replace UTF-8 character from a shell? The examples use stdin, but I need something that works for perl file too. com to see the new experience. Older coding types takes only 1 byte, General questions, relating to UTF or Encoding Forms. if you use the character encoding for Unicode text called UTF-8, MARC 21 Specifications for Record Structure, Character Sets, The UTF-8 transformation of a Unicode scalar value into an octet sequence is accomplished by # Encodings, UTF-8 and Python In the previous lesson we said that Unicode was an _abstract_ catalog that mapped symbols to _code points_. :- data is processed in MS Excell and saved as Unicode file- I read the file into SAP, process the strings and write it backThe problem is that there are some special polish characters in the file. They are: This topic lists all UTF-8 conversion routines. Free unicode, escaped unicode, decimal NCRs, Hexadecimal NCRs, UTF8 code conversion in IE I'm able to set encoding to UTF-8 to use Unicode characters set while typing e. This is a video presentation of the Detail. What's a Character Set? A character set is a fixed collection of symbols. Stream (includ Today, I will start my series of articles about SQL Server and Unicode UTF-8 Encoding. FreeTDS is a data communications library that of course connects to databases, which are charged with storing information in a way that is neutral to all architectures and languages. encoding="UTF-8" ? - not working In IE if I go to View>Encoding it is set to Unicode not Unicode (UTF-8). In Java, all strings are encoded in UTF-16, except for conversion from bytes to strings (via InputStreamReader or similar) and from strings to bytes (OutputStreamWriter etc. For example, if your source viewer only supports Windows-1252, but the page is encoded as UTF-8, you can select text from your source viewer, paste it Choose text encoding when you open and Unicode accommodates most characters sets across all the languages (UCS-2 little-endian and big-endian, UTF-8, Unicode is a digital code for computers that lets them show text in different languages. A simple, portable and lightweight generic library for handling UTF-8 encoded strings. While Unicode-enabled functions in Windows use UTF Consider: Is it true that unicode=utf16? Many are saying Unicode is a standard, not an encoding, but most editors support save as Unicode encoding actually. Convert unicode characters like a total winner. if i have a list with a series of Unicode code point values as ints and want to convert to a list of utf-8 code values as ints, how could i achieve this in Python? the reverse would be nice, too. UltraEdit / UEStudio provides support for Unicode (16-bit wide character, or UTF-16) and UTF-8 files. 3 (released in early 2010) introduced a new encoding called utf8mb4 which maps to proper UTF-8 and thus fully supports Unicode, Unicode (English to English translation). UTF-8(ユーティーエフはち、ユーティーエフエイト)はISO/IEC 10646 (UCS) とUnicodeで使える8ビット符号単位の文字符号化形式及び文字符号化スキーム。 Free Download UTF-8 converter 1. Proper Unicode will never produce more than 4 chars, "Reading UTF-8 with C++ streams" A "Unicode character" is a code point in the Unicode table. Unicode® character table. Translate Unicode to English online and download now our free translation software to use at any time. 3. Unicode utf-8 Free Download,Unicode utf-8 Software Collection Download Vietnamese Unicode FAQs . 01/19/2017; 2 minutes to read Contributors. Whether a driver should be a Unicode driver or an ANSI driver depends entirely on the nature of the data source. The presence of nulls embedded in character data and of byte order issues make straight Unicode i. 2, “The utf8mb3 Character Set (3-Byte UTF-8 Unicode Encoding)”. It is a variable-width encoding and a strict superset of ASCII. Unicode vs UTF-8 The development of Unicode was aimed at creating a new standard for mapping the characters in a great majority of languages that are being used today, along with other characters that are not that essential but might be necessary for creating the text. If this is zero they are instead turned into the Unicode REPLACEMENT CHARACTER, of value 0xfffd. UTF-8 has the following properties: Unicode characters U+0000 (00000000) to U+007F (01111111) are encoded simply as bytes 0×00 to 0×7F (ASCII compatibility). 8 only save utf-8 with BOM? #10583. Search this site. Code page 65001. Vietnamese accents. Third, click the mouse on Unicode (UTF-8). Edit. (26 uppercase letters, 26 lower case. utf-8 characters The Mutt mail user agent has very good Unicode support. Unicode File Handling in ABAP August 18, 2005 The ABAP file interface employs UTF-8 for Unicode files. unicode to utf 8